Faint M-dwarf Doubles from the Sloan Digital Sky Survey. Brian A. Skiff, Lowell Observatory, 1400 West Mars Hill Road, Flagstaff AZ 86001-4499, USA e-mail: bas@lowell.edu This report is the fourth in a series presenting doubles identified while preparing various spectral surveys in machine-readable form. All the pairs in this installment were found while checking over the list of 44,000 faint M dwarfs classified by Andrew West et al (2008). The spectra were taken as part of the Sloan Digital Sky Survey, and include stars observed in Data Release 5. A curious aspect of the list is that a significant fraction of the stars were observed essentially by mistake. The SDSS aimed to acquire spectra (and redshifts) for something like a million galaxies and quasars. Stars were observed {\it inter alia} to allocate otherwise unused fibers in any particular field-plate that fed the multi-object spectrograph. Although a complete variety of stars was inevitably observed, many M-dwarf targets were chosen preferentially by being `nonstellar' and having photometric colors resembling galaxies or quasars with large redshifts. The M-dwarf pairs are commonly flagged in the photometric catalogue as being galaxies, and their red colors indicated high redshift. But the nonstellar aspect resulted from their being near-equal double stars --- not galaxies --- that were not properly resolved by the image-reduction software pipeline. Thus the sample of M dwarfs classified by West et al includes large numbers of these unrecognized binaries. This skews the analysis of the data: among other things, the stars are at nearly twice the distances that were determined, since the individual stars are about 0.75 mag fainter than the authors assumed. Such near-equal M-dwarf binaries are not common in the population of nearby stars within 25pc, so this sample is a biased one. To find the pairs I simply examined sky-survey images, including of course the high-resolution SDSS images, but also available Schmidt plate-scans, and the 2MASS survey. The long temporal baseline of the Schmidt plates and Sloan images allows one to check for optical pairs. As a result, even though many of the pairs have only a single measure, essentially all must be physical. Because of the somewhat irregular images on the various Schmidt plates, sometimes the derived proper motions are incorrect in, for example, USNO-B1.0. Thus few of these pairs are identifiable simply by looking in the catalogues for common-motion stars in close proximity. The images and photometry in various passbands across the visible spectrum permit one to recognize white-dwarf companions by their very blue colors. In the Sloan images, it can be surprising to see the relative brightness of these pairs reverse dramatically between the g-band and the i-band images. The SDSS photometric catalogue {\emph sometimes} shows separate entries for the two stars, but in other cases I measured them approximately using large-scale image cut-outs from the Goddard SkyView utility. These are flagged as `estimate' in the table below. When the stars are resolved in the catalogue I show magnitudes and sometimes spectral types directly for both components, while for the others I used the combined-light brightness and eye-estimates of delta-mag to get the separate magnitudes. For close pairs, I could sometimes used the Carlsberg meridian-circle catalogue (Evans et al 2002), which has much lower angular resolution, to confirm that the SDSS magnitude was for the combined light of the system. When the pairs are several arcseconds apart, it was possible to get additional measures of separation and position-angle from other astrometric sources such as 2MASS and even the catalogues based on scans of the Schmidt sky surveys. Extending the temporal baseline of the measurements is essential in establishing the physical link between the stars since the catalogued proper motions are sometimes incorrect. Sometimes the star observed for spectral type is not the primary; these are distinctive in the list by having the M-type classification in the second of the columns showing the types. I have tried to give an estimate of the type of primary from the photometric colors. The SDSS spectrograph fibers were 3" diameter, and so pairs with separation under 1".5 were probably observed together, if only because the seeing spread the light from both stars into the fiber. The magnitudes are close to standard V, derived from the Sloan g and r magnitudes simply from g+r/2, which for the present purposes is close enough, and are rounded always to 0.1-mag precision. In a few cases there is legitimate V-band photometry published, sufficient to show that this simple expedient is valid. The 300 or so pairs listed here are by no means complete. In the gore of Right Ascension between 8h and 9h I did examine all the stars brighter than Sloan r magnitude 19.0. In other regions groups of stars were checked pretty much at random as my interest was piqued. Thus there remain thousands of such pairs to be extracted from the catalogue. Similar results for over 1300 new common-motion pairs were published from the same dataset by Saurav Dhital et al (2010). These pairs match in both proper motion and radial-velocity determined from the same Sloan spectra. These are referred to as `SLoWPoKES' pairs, which now have the acronym `SLW' in the WDS. Most of these lack mesasurement at multiple epochs, though the proper motions should be reliable at the wide separations involved. The pairs listed here have separations altogether closer, typically 1" - 2", rather than some tens of arcseconds common amongst the SLW pairs. The cabal led by Andrew West has more recently published spectral types for another 70,000 Sloan M dwarfs (West et al 2011). These come from the SDSS DR7 catalogue plus additional unpublished spectroscopic plates. Though there is considerable overlap with the first pass through the data, more close pairs similar to the ones here have been easy to find, and a selection will be forthcoming. J., {\bf 141}, 97, 2011 ******************************************************************************** Notes WDS 00004-1052 Only the primary is a spectroscopically-confirmed white dwarf, but both stars are blue. WDS 00188+0017 The redder Sloan and 2MASS images suggest the secondary could be a close (~0".5) pair. WDS 00243+0021 The secondary seems to be involved with a fainter background star. WDS 08369+1905 This pair is a likely member of the Praesepe cluster. WDS 12083+0846 The AB pair clearly have common motion, but the primary is not bright enough to be an ordinary dwarf, so must be a cool degenerate star. In addition, the very faint spectroscopically-identified white dwarf seems much too faint to be linked with the M9 dwarf, so it could be optical. I'm not sure what's going on here!
